The Hardest Block

What’s the hardest block of all?

One that will probably cause your downfall?

A block of metal, a block of cheese,

A block of century-old pine trees?

 

A stumbling block--that’s challenging!

It’s your hurdle, that hard-to-overcome thing.

But since, if you try, you can make your path clear,

A stumbling block is not much to fear.

 

Or those blocks you must walk to get to school?

They make your feet hurt--SO not cool!

But hey, exercise is truly sublime!

You’re healthy and have a longer lifetime.

 

Aha! Writer’s block is hard. You see,

It happens in both prose and poetry.

You can’t write a thing! You’re simply struck dumb.

Your mind is blank, it feels a bit numb.

 

So the hardest block of all must be

Writer’s block! For you’ll pay many a fee,

Boredom! Helplessness! Wasted time!

Just because you can’t write or rhyme…

 

OH NO! I’ve got writer’s block!

 

By Cynthia, age 12, Tallahassee, FL
